*** Test looking up a lot of different event positions and GTIDs.
CREATE FUNCTION gtid_eq(a VARCHAR(255), b VARCHAR(255)) RETURNS BOOLEAN DETERMINISTIC
BEGIN
DECLARE g VARCHAR(255);
IF a IS NULL OR b IS NULL OR LENGTH(a) != LENGTH(b) THEN
RETURN FALSE;
END IF;
SET a= CONCAT(a, ',');
SET b= CONCAT(',', b, ',');
WHILE LENGTH(a) > 0 DO
SET g= REGEXP_SUBSTR(a, '^[^,]+,');
SET a= SUBSTRING(a, LENGTH(g)+1);
SET b= REPLACE(b, CONCAT(',', g), ',');
END WHILE;
RETURN b = ',';
END //
